24 HR ascorbic acid 320 mg / folic acid 1 mg / iron carbonyl 100 mg / vitamin B12 0.025 mg Extended Release Oral Capsule [Icar-C Plus]
RxNorm 1111197

Concept Hierarchy & Relationship Mapping

RxNorm Concept Unique Identifier (RxCUI) 1111197 represents a standardized clinical drug concept used for cross-system interoperability. This concept aggregates multiple Atom IDs (AUIs), which are specific naming variations and synonyms used across pharmaceutical databases to ensure accurate medication mapping for: 24 HR ascorbic acid 320 mg / folic acid 1 mg / iron carbonyl 100 mg / vitamin B12 0.025 mg Extended Release Oral Capsule [Icar-C Plus].
